[–]EnvironmentalAnt6518[S] 21 points22 points  (0 children)

I chose this branch because it gives me the broadest possible patient base and allows me to handle a wide spectrum of pathologies without limiting myself to a single organ system. I’ve always wanted to be the first point of contact for an entire family—someone who can understand them as a unit and integrate all their healthcare needs in one place. I genuinely enjoy OPDs, so this specialty felt like a natural fit. Where I come from, people don’t primarily need specialists—they need a strong generalist who can evaluate most conditions, diagnose early, and prevent disease progression to the point where specialist intervention becomes necessary. Basically reducing the financial and mental burden of patient and the family. Ultimateltly aim is to develop enough depth and breadth of knowledge so I can deliver the best possible initial management and also create sustainable long-term plans, ultimately ensuring comprehensive care that truly serves the patient’s best interests.
